Title 2 › Chapter 12— CONTESTED ELECTIONS › § 393
File papers like pleadings, motions, depositions, appendixes, and briefs by either delivering a copy to the Clerk at the House of Representatives office in Washington, D.C. (or to a staff member there) or by registered or certified mail to that address. If a mailed copy isn’t actually received, file another copy within a reasonable time, and send any extra copies the committee’s rules require at the same time. The Clerk must promptly send everything he receives to the committee.
